Special needs Daycares in Peoria AZ provides a safe and nurturing environment for children with various needs. These daycares focus on helping kids with developmental disabilities, such as autism, learn and grow. They offer tailored programs that support each child's unique abilities and challenges. Parents can feel confident knowing their children are in a supportive setting that understands their needs.
Many families look for an inclusive daycare in Peoria that welcomes all children, regardless of their abilities. These centers often provide adaptive daycare in Peoria that adjusts activities to fit different skill levels. This approach helps all children play and learn together, promoting friendships and understanding. Parents can also find autism-friendly daycare in Peoria that specifically caters to children on the autism spectrum, ensuring they receive the right support.
Some daycares in Peoria offer therapeutic daycare in Peoria AZ, which includes special activities designed to help children develop important skills. These centers often have sensory-friendly daycare in Peoria options that create calm spaces for children who may feel overwhelmed. This type of environment can help kids with sensory sensitivities feel more comfortable and engaged in their learning.
Early intervention is crucial for children with special needs. Many daycares provide early intervention services in Peoria AZ to help children reach their full potential. These services can include speech therapy, occupational therapy, and more. Additionally, special needs programs in Peoria focus on specific skills and learning goals, ensuring that each child receives the support they need to thrive.
Finding the right daycare can be challenging for families. Fortunately, many centers offer special needs support in Peoria AZ to assist parents in their search. Some daycares also provide respite care in Peoria, giving parents a much-needed break while ensuring their child is well cared for. Many centers host special needs playgroups in Peoria AZ, allowing children to socialize and build friendships in a safe environment.
Located in the heart of the **Valley of the Sun**, Peoria, AZ is a vibrant city that offers a unique blend of suburban charm and urban amenities. Nestled just northwest of Phoenix, Peoria is part of the larger metropolitan area, making it an ideal location for those seeking a balance between city life and a relaxed lifestyle. With its stunning desert landscapes and picturesque mountain views, Peoria is a haven for outdoor enthusiasts and families alike.
One of the standout features of Peoria, AZ is its commitment to community and recreation. The city boasts over 30 parks, including the expansive **Lake Pleasant Regional Park**, which is perfect for boating, fishing, and hiking. This natural oasis not only provides recreational opportunities but also serves as a gathering place for community events and festivals throughout the year.
In addition to its outdoor offerings, Peoria is home to a thriving arts and culture scene. The **Peoria Center for the Performing Arts** hosts a variety of shows, from theater productions to concerts, enriching the local cultural landscape. The city also celebrates its rich history through various museums and historical sites, allowing residents and visitors to connect with Peoria's past.
The sense of community in Peoria, AZ is palpable, with numerous events that bring residents together. The annual **Peoria Art and Cultural Festival** showcases local artists and musicians, fostering a spirit of creativity and collaboration. Additionally, the city’s commitment to education is evident through its highly-rated schools and community programs, making it a desirable place for families to settle down.
Peoria's diverse population contributes to a rich tapestry of cultures and traditions, enhancing the community experience. Local businesses thrive in the area, offering unique dining, shopping, and entertainment options that reflect the city's dynamic character.
What sets Peoria, AZ apart is its blend of modern conveniences and natural beauty. The city is strategically located near major highways, providing easy access to downtown Phoenix and other neighboring cities. This accessibility makes Peoria an attractive option for commuters who wish to enjoy a quieter lifestyle without sacrificing the benefits of city living.
Moreover, Peoria is known for its warm climate, with over 300 days of sunshine each year, making it a year-round destination for outdoor activities. Whether you're hiking in the **Sonoran Desert**, enjoying a round of golf at one of the many local courses, or simply soaking up the sun at a community pool, Peoria offers endless opportunities for recreation and relaxation.
